Overview

Flat tubes are engineered with a rectangular or oval cross-section instead of the traditional circular profile, optimizing them for space-constrained applications. They are critical in industries where efficient heat transfer and compact design are paramount, such as automotive cooling systems and industrial heat exchangers. Their flattened shape increases the contact area between the tube and adjacent components, enhancing thermal performance. Manufacturers produce flat tubes through extrusion or roll-forming processes, with materials chosen based on thermal conductivity and environmental resistance. Aluminum alloys dominate automotive applications due to their lightweight properties, while copper and stainless steel are preferred for high-corrosion environments.

Structure and Working Principle

The structure of a flat tube comprises two parallel wide surfaces connected by narrower sides, creating an elongated flow path for fluids. This geometry reduces aerodynamic resistance in applications like radiator cores, allowing for denser fin arrangements and improved heat dissipation. Internally, some designs incorporate micro-channels to further boost efficiency by increasing turbulence. During operation, heat transfers from the fluid inside the tube to the external environment (or vice versa) through the tube walls. The large surface area accelerates this process compared to round tubes, making flat tubes ideal for temperature-sensitive systems. Their mechanical strength is carefully calibrated to withstand internal pressure without deformation.

Key Features

Flat tubes excel in thermal efficiency due to their high surface-area-to-volume ratio, often achieving 20–30% better heat transfer than equivalent round tubes. Their compact profile enables modular designs in equipment like condensers, reducing overall system size. Many variants feature internal baffles or ridges to disrupt laminar flow, enhancing mixing and heat exchange. Durability is another hallmark, with materials like AA3003 aluminum offering excellent corrosion resistance in coolant systems. Customization options include varied wall thicknesses (typically 0.2–1.5 mm) and coatings (e.g., hydrophilic layers for HVAC systems) to match specific operational demands.

Application Areas

The automotive industry relies heavily on flat tubes for radiator cores, charge air coolers, and evaporators in air conditioning systems. Their space-saving design aligns with modern vehicle compactness requirements. In HVACR (Heating, Ventilation, Air Conditioning, and Refrigeration), flat tubes form the backbone of condenser and evaporator coils, improving energy efficiency. Industrial applications include oil coolers, power plant heat recovery systems, and solar thermal collectors. Emerging uses involve battery thermal management in electric vehicles, where precise temperature control is critical. The tubes’ adaptability to brazing and welding processes facilitates integration into complex assemblies.

Maintenance and Precautions

Routine inspection for leaks or corrosion at the tube’s flattened edges is essential, as stress concentrations may occur there. In systems with hard water or corrosive fluids, periodic descaling or chemical flushing prevents internal fouling. Avoid mechanical impacts during installation, as dents can restrict flow and impair performance. For aluminum tubes, galvanic corrosion risks arise when coupled with dissimilar metals like copper; insulating gaskets or coatings mitigate this. Storage should prioritize dry environments to prevent oxidation, especially for uncoated variants. Pressure testing during procurement ensures compliance with operational requirements.

B2B Procurement Guide

Industrial buyers should specify material grades (e.g., AL6061 for high-strength needs), dimensional tolerances (±0.1 mm is common), and certifications like ISO 9001 or ASTM B491. Bulk purchases (e.g., 10,000+ meters) often attract volume discounts of 10–15%. Lead times vary from 2–8 weeks depending on customization. Reputable suppliers provide test reports for tensile strength and burst pressure. Consider partnering with manufacturers offering in-house tooling for custom profiles. For international procurement, factor in shipping costs for delicate tubes, which may require protective packaging to prevent deformation.
